X-RAY DIFFRACTION

Crystallization Details
Method pH Temprature Details
X-RAY DIFFRACTION 6.9 291 9.0 MG/ML WEE1, 25 mM Na/K phosphate, 1 mM DTT, 0.05 M ammonium sulfate, 0.05 M Bis-tris (pH 5.5), 7.5 % PEG 3350, 1 mM PF-03814735
Unit Cell:
a: 50.520 Å b: 45.710 Å c: 59.440 Å α: 90.000° β: 102.520° γ: 90.000°
Symmetry:
Space Group: P 1 21 1
Crystal Properties:
Matthew's Coefficient: 2.07 Solvent Content: 40.44
